Please state the nature of the issue(s) that you may be encountering.

You have a ' Serv-U FTP Server' which can be either a good thing or bad depending upon the circumstances of its installation and configuration:

http://www3.ca.com/securityadvisor/p...x?id=453074721

It can be used for one of the following purposes: a legitimate or illicit FTP server, a backdoor invader, or a trojan. Did you set this up yourself or what?
